site stats

Close div on click outside react

WebuseOnClickOutside This hook allows you to detect clicks outside of a specified element. In the example below we use it to close a modal when any element outside of the modal is … Web1. Mở đầu Trong bài viết này, mình xin trình bày phương pháp viết function xử lý sự kiện ( event) Click Outside trong Reactjs. Trong ứng dụng Web chúng ta thường gặp function này trong các khối UI như Tooltip, Modal hay Dropdown, và thường được xử lý sẵn bởi các Library như Bootstrap, Material-ui ,... 2. Ý tưởng

useOnClickOutside React Hook - useHooks

WebJan 27, 2024 · import * as React from 'react' import useOnClickOutside from 'use-onclickoutside' export default function Modal ( { close }) { const ref = React.useRef (null) … WebDec 9, 2014 · //Basic Html snippet Document click outside this div to test Check click outside //Implementation in Vanilla javaScript const node = document.getElementById ('mydiv') //minor css to make div more obvious node.style.width = '300px' node.style.height = '100px' node.style.background = 'red' let isCursorInside = false //Attach mouseover … hunningham cricket club https://floriomotori.com

how to dismiss dropdown when click outside? - Stack Overflow

WebSep 15, 2024 · Dismiss Popover on Outside Click Let's look at the two simplest ways of dismissing the popover. Use rootClose Prop You can pass the additional prop rootClose to your OverlayTrigger component to dismiss the popover when on an outside click. 1 ... 2 3 ... jsx WebCreate a handler for the child div's onClick event handler, which stops the propagation/bubbling up of the event to the parent. Refer to Event.stopPropagation method for more info. class SomeComponent extends Component { handleCloseButton = e => { // This stops the event from bubbling up. { setDp ("block"); }} > Test Test ); } export default hide; marty levy insurance

React Detect Outside Click to Hide Dropdown Element Tutorial

Category:How to handle click outside a div in React with a custom …

Tags:Close div on click outside react

Close div on click outside react

Detect click outside React component using hooks

WebClick-Away Listener is a utility component that listens for click events outside of its child. (Note that it only accepts one child element.) This is useful for components like the … WebJun 24, 2024 · How to handle click outside a div in React with a custom hook This is a very important thing, especially when creating dropdowns. The user expects the dropdown to …

Close div on click outside react

Did you know?

WebOct 3, 2024 · I have a react component which I want to self close when I click a button that's on the component itself. Here's the code: import React from 'react'; import … WebMay 10, 2024 · Close Div When Clicking Outside of It No more document.addEventListener (‘click’, …) 1. Create a button to open a popup and a popup itself

Webvar ignoreClickOnMeElement = document.getElementById('someElementID'); document.addEventListener('click', function(event) { var isClickInsideElement = ignoreClickOnMeElement.contains(event.target); if (!isClickInsideElement) { //Do something click is outside specified element } }); 23 detect a click outside an element javascript WebApr 18, 2016 · The tricky part is that the div will contain other elements and if one of the elements inside the div is clicked, it should be considered a click inside, the same way if …

WebSep 24, 2024 · If you want to learn more about React, here’s an article on how to get URL params in React (with React Router V5/V6 and without). Join me on Twitter for daily doses of educational content to help you … WebFeb 7, 2024 · Reactjs hide div when click outside or click men. Ask Question. Asked 1 year, 2 months ago. Modified 1 year, 2 months ago. Viewed 8k times. 1. I am creating …

WebDec 21, 2024 · < div className = "title" > Overview < / div > < br / > < p > The Sidebar component is a collapsible side content placed along with the main content either in left or right side of the page.

WebMar 3, 2024 · Let’s try it out ourselves, try clicking inside and outside of the pink background. Also use Tab and Shift + Tab keys ( in Chrome, Firefox, Edge ) or Opt/Alt + … marty lindsey state farm durhamWebOct 11, 2015 · (function () { // click outside of element to hide it let hels = []; window.hidable = (el, excepter, hider) => { // hider takes el as the only arg hels.push ( [el, excepter, hider]); return el; } window.addEventListener ('click', e=> { for (let i = 0; i < hels.length; i++) { let el = hels [i] [0]; let excepter = hels [i] [1]; let hider = hels [i] … marty lipton wachtellWebFeb 11, 2024 · Step 1: Create a React application using the following command: npx create-react-app foldername Step 2: After creating your project folder i.e. foldername, move to it using the following command: cd foldername Project Structure: It will look like the following. Project Structure App.js: Now write down the following code in the App.js file. hunningford nursery prince george bc